The Neighbors (2023)
Location
NoName Theatre, Helsinki, Finland
Date
08 April 2023 until 19 April 2023.
Storyline
A comedy authored and directed by H.S. Fernandez inspired by Mike Leigh's "Abigail's Party". This is a modern spin on the age-old question of "impressing the guests", and it follows the story of Kenneth and Aurora, a modern couple living in a state-of-the-art home managed by an AI entity named Dexter. The play explores the challenges the couple faces as they try to showcase their home to guests during a housewarming party, all while dealing with Dexter's constant sabotage (as well as their own, personal shortcomings).
This side-splitting comedy showcases the unpredictable and uncontrollable nature of artificial intelligence in a lighthearted and entertaining way.
